0
  • 聊天消息
  • 系统消息
  • 评论与回复
登录后你可以
  • 下载海量资料
  • 学习在线课程
  • 观看技术视频
  • 写文章/发帖/加入社区
会员中心
创作中心

完善资料让更多小伙伴认识你,还能领取20积分哦,立即完善>

3天内不再提示

基于RK3568 + FPGA国产平台的多通道AD实时采集显示方案分享

Tronlong创龙科技 2025-03-28 10:11 次阅读
加入交流群
微信小助手二维码

扫码添加小助手

加入工程师交流群

工业控制与数据采集领域,高精度AD采集和实时显示至关重要。今天,我们就来基于瑞芯微RK3568J + FPGA国产平台深入探讨以下,它是如何实现该功能的。适用开发环境如下:

Windows开发环境:Windows 7 64bit、Windows 10 64bit

Linux开发环境:Ubuntu18.04.4 64bit、VMware15.5.5

U-Boot:U-Boot-2017.09

Kernel:Linux-4.19.232、Linux-RT-4.19.232

LinuxSDK:LinuxSDK-[版本号](基于rk356x_linux_release_v1.3.1_20221120)

AMP SDK:rk356x_amp_sdk_release_v1.2.3_20230515

Pango Design Suite(PDS):PDS_2022.2-SP3

硬件开发环境:创龙科技TL3568F-EVM评估板(瑞芯微RK3568J+紫光同创Logos-2)、TL7606P模块(CL1606/AD7606芯片,8通道,采样率200KSPS)、TL7616P模块(CL1616/AD7616芯片,16通道,采样率1MSPS)。

测试数据汇总

测试数据汇总如下:

表 1

wKgZO2fmBOeAW8xSAAD1JhEAIMA047.png

RK3568J + FPGA国产平台

瑞芯微RK3568J/RK3568B2处理器集成了四核ARM
Cortex-A55处理器,主频高达1.8GHz/2.0GHz。创龙科技基于瑞芯微RK3568J/RK3568B2 + 紫光同创Logos-2
PG2L50H/PG2L100H FPGA,推出了SOM-TL3568F工业核心板和TL3568F-EVM评估板。

值得一提的是,创龙科技SOM-TL3568F核心板的ARM、FPGA、ROMRAM电源、晶振、连接器等所有元器件均采用国产工业级方案,国产化率100%!

此外,RK3568J+ FPGA评估板具备丰富的接口资源,包括3路Ethernet、3路USB、3路CANRS422/RS485、2路SFP、FMC等通信接口,以及MIPI
LCD、LVDS LCD、TFT LCD、HDMI OUT等视频接口,满足客户的项目评估需求!

RK3568J + FPGA核心板典型应用领域

pcie_ad_display案例演示

为了简化描述,本文仅摘录部分方案功能描述与测试结果。

案例说明

案例基于FPGA端采集8/16通道AD数据,ARM端CPU3核心运行RT-Thread(RTOS)程序,并通过PCIe总线从FPGA端接收AD数据。

ARM端CPU0、CPU1、CPU2核心运行Linux系统,CUP3核心(运行RT-Thread(RTOS)程序)通过rpmsg将AD数据发送至Linux应用程序,Linux应用程序通过rpmsg接收RT-Thread(RTOS)发送的AD数据,并将数据转换得到电压值,然后通过Qt显示波形至显示屏。

备注:本案例目前仅支持在CPU3核心运行RT-Thread(RTOS)程序。

系统工作示意框图如下所示。

wKgZPGfmBO-ATjPFAAEMtF0UwAw526.png

图 2 系统工作示意框图

案例演示

请将创龙科技TL7606P模块连接至评估板FPGA EXPORT(CON26)接口,将HDMI显示器与评估板HDMI OUT接口连接,将评估板USB TO UART2串口、RS232 UART0串口连接至PC机,硬件连接如下图所示。

图 3

案例支持TL7606P模块8通道同时采集与显示。本次测试以TL7606P模块V1和V5通道为例,请分别正确连接至信号发生器A通道和B通道。信号发生器设置A通道输出频率为200Hz、峰峰值为6.0Vpp(即幅值为3.0V)的正弦波信号,B通道输出频率为1KHz、峰峰值为6.0Vpp(即幅值为3.0V)的正弦波信号。

请参考产品资料完成环境配置,将本案例FPGA程序固化至FPGA运行,将amp.img镜像文件固化至评估板。将案例可执行程序拷贝至评估板文件系统后,执行如下命令,以连续模式采集数据。

Target# ./pcie_ad_display -d ad7606 -m 2

wKgZO2fmBPuARwPBAACBGLWN3rQ248.png

图 4

同时,HDMI显示屏将会实时显示动态波形,如下图所示。

wKgZPGfmBQOAFwcBAAGhZvhJiX8615.png

图 5

当你想停止程序运行时,按下"Ctrl + C"可停止程序运行。

wKgZO2fmBQuAXLv_AAC8ZyJSpgs956.png

图 6

到这里,我们的演示步骤结束。想要查看更多瑞芯微RK3568J + FPGA国产平台更多相关的案例演示,欢迎各位工程师在公众号(Tronlong创龙科技)查阅,快来试试吧!

声明:本文内容及配图由入驻作者撰写或者入驻合作网站授权转载。文章观点仅代表作者本人,不代表电子发烧友网立场。文章及其配图仅供工程师学习之用,如有内容侵权或者其他违规问题,请联系本站处理。 举报投诉
  • 嵌入式开发
    +关注

    关注

    18

    文章

    1102

    浏览量

    49831
  • 瑞芯微
    +关注

    关注

    27

    文章

    699

    浏览量

    53451
  • 国产处理器
    +关注

    关注

    1

    文章

    19

    浏览量

    6450
收藏 人收藏
加入交流群
微信小助手二维码

扫码添加小助手

加入工程师交流群

    评论

    相关推荐
    热点推荐

    RK3568J“麒麟”+“翼辉”国产系统正式发布,“鸿蒙”也正在路上!

    本帖最后由 Tronlong创龙科技 于 2024-7-19 17:16 编辑 RK3568J ”麒麟“ + “翼辉”国产系统正式发布 近期,创龙科技RK3568J全国产
    发表于 07-09 11:44

    国产RK3568J基于FSPI的ARM+FPGA通信方案分享

    FPGA功耗较小。一般而言,低功耗器件的使用寿命也将更长。 基于FSPI的ARM + FPGA通信实测数据分享 硬件方案一:创龙科技TL3568F-EVM评估板(
    发表于 07-17 10:50

    紫光同创Logos2+RK3568开发板|国产器件强强联合开启嵌入式开发新篇章

    ,能够为大量数据的快速传输开辟高速通道,满足诸如在通道 AD 采集处理系统中,FPGA采集
    发表于 05-14 18:04

    国产工业级RK3568核心板-AI人脸识别产品方案

    ,自动对焦等功能的摄像头模组,以保证图像质量和拍摄效果。在图像采集的过程中,可以使用RK3568内置的ISP图像处理单元对图像进行优化,提高人脸识别的准确率和稳定性。 LCD显示屏:目前提供7寸MIPI屏
    发表于 05-06 14:30

    RK3568J“麒麟”+“翼辉”国产系统正式发布,“鸿蒙”也正在路上!

    RK3568J ”麒麟“ + “翼辉”国产系统正式发布 近期,创龙科技RK3568J全国产平台国产
    发表于 11-30 16:08

    迅为国产瑞芯微RK3568工业级核心板方案

    迅为国产瑞芯微RK3568工业级核心板方案
    的头像 发表于 07-06 15:12 2711次阅读
    迅为<b class='flag-5'>国产</b>瑞芯微<b class='flag-5'>RK3568</b>工业级核心板<b class='flag-5'>方案</b>

    国产工业级RK3568核心板-AI人脸识别产品方案

    国产工业级RK3568核心板-AI人脸识别产品方案
    的头像 发表于 05-06 14:51 1934次阅读
    <b class='flag-5'>国产</b>工业级<b class='flag-5'>RK3568</b>核心板-AI人脸识别产品<b class='flag-5'>方案</b>

    迅为RK3568开发板可实现屏异显控方案

    迅为RK3568开发板可实现屏异显控方案
    的头像 发表于 07-15 17:30 2613次阅读
    迅为<b class='flag-5'>RK3568</b>开发板可实现<b class='flag-5'>多</b>屏异显控<b class='flag-5'>方案</b>

    RK3568--基于AMP的通道AD采集开发案

    RK3568--基于AMP的通道AD采集开发案
    的头像 发表于 01-19 10:03 1685次阅读
    <b class='flag-5'>RK3568</b>--基于AMP的<b class='flag-5'>多</b><b class='flag-5'>通道</b>AD<b class='flag-5'>采集</b>开发案

    RK3568-ARM+FPGA通信案例开发手册 (一)

    RK3568-ARM+FPGA通信案例开发手册 (一)
    的头像 发表于 01-19 10:31 2206次阅读
    <b class='flag-5'>RK3568-ARM+FPGA</b>通信案例开发手册 (一)

    RK3568--基于AMP的通道AD采集开发案(二)

    RK3568--基于AMP的通道AD采集开发案(二)
    的头像 发表于 01-19 10:34 1500次阅读
    <b class='flag-5'>RK3568</b>--基于AMP的<b class='flag-5'>多</b><b class='flag-5'>通道</b>AD<b class='flag-5'>采集</b>开发案(二)

    RK3568--系统启动阶段LOGO显示

    RK3568--系统启动阶段LOGO显示
    的头像 发表于 01-19 14:44 2171次阅读
    <b class='flag-5'>RK3568</b>--系统启动阶段LOGO<b class='flag-5'>显示</b>

    案例分享!RK3568 + FPGA通道AD采集处理与显示

    案例展示测试数据汇总表1本文带来的是基于瑞芯微RK3568J+紫光同创Logos-2的ARM+FPGA通道AD采集处理与
    的头像 发表于 06-27 15:19 1888次阅读
    案例分享!<b class='flag-5'>RK3568</b> + <b class='flag-5'>FPGA</b><b class='flag-5'>多</b><b class='flag-5'>通道</b>AD<b class='flag-5'>采集</b>处理与<b class='flag-5'>显示</b>

    基于迅为RK3568开发板全国产平台,快速实现APP开机自启动技术分享

    基于迅为RK3568开发板全国产平台,快速实现APP开机自启动技术分享
    的头像 发表于 11-21 13:58 1406次阅读
    基于迅为<b class='flag-5'>RK3568</b>开发板全<b class='flag-5'>国产</b><b class='flag-5'>平台</b>,快速实现APP开机自启动技术分享

    迅为RK3568 重制版RK3568驱动指南全面升级

    迅为RK3568 重制版RK3568驱动指南全面升级
    的头像 发表于 07-28 15:25 1483次阅读
    迅为<b class='flag-5'>RK3568</b> 重制版<b class='flag-5'>RK3568</b>驱动指南全面升级